New York Preservation Archive Project-35th Anniversary Celebration of the 1973 Admendments to the NYC Landmarks Law (New York, NY)

On June 10th, NYPAP ( New York Preservation Archive Project) hosted a event celebrating the 1973 Admendments to the NYC Landmarks Law.

It was split into two parts. The first part was a panel discussion held at the Fraunces Tavern Museum located in downtown Manhattan on 45 Pearl Street. With the dialog and interaction between the panelist, the was revelation into the formulation and fruition of the 1973 admendments.

The second part was the the long awaited cocktail party at the Battery Garden Restaurant.
At the Garden all of us that were present that eveing raised our glasses and saluted those that have contributed to the historic preservation cause.

World Science Festival 2008 @ the Metropolitian Museum of Art (New York, NY)

On June 1st, the Metropolitan Museum of Art located on the historic Museum Mile on 5th Avenue and 82nd Street, hosted a symposium entitled "The Science of Art". This event was part of the five day World Science Festival held in New York City.

The purpose of the panel was to explore the complex and intricate relationship between the world of science and the world of art.
